Transaction 9aa96c77535b1f4ef4a18af742b79bcb7e118d6f9f15dfc2b300dc21dc241bae
1 Input
2 Outputs
- 9aa96c77535b1f4ef4a18af742b79bcb7e118d6f9f15dfc2b300dc21dc241bae:0
- 9aa96c77535b1f4ef4a18af742b79bcb7e118d6f9f15dfc2b300dc21dc241bae:1
value 93669
address 184dACdCwYctMm79UUFV2Cu4cJAnkXpftq
value 2620240185
address 14cx2rUpe7FsdvyjTYbCAJQDh1F9KXgfyx